WebJul 30, 2024 · A mole's damage to a lawn or plant is accidental since they, unlike voles, don't eat plants. Most of the time, a mole causes little damage other than an unsightly raised bed or a tunnel in the lawn. In a way, they're actually helpful critters as they aerate the soil. WebDaffodils contain lycorine, a compound that repels animals, including chipmunks and voles. Note that this popular plant is toxic for pets, and its sap may cause skin irritation, which is why it is one of the best plants that keep moles away, as well as chipmunks. Set daffodil bulbs out in the fall, two to four weeks before the ground freezes. WebFeb 22, 2024 · Given a choice, moles pick moist, sandy loam soils over dry, heavy clay soils.
